Vancouver Film School has created a program for aspiring visual storytellers to explore career opportunities in film and television. Foundation – Film is a four-month preparatory program that introduces students to the fundamentals of screenwriting, cinematography, directing, producing, post-production, sound design, and more. 

Students receive hands-on experience with industry-standard equipment and software, while participating in shoots that will build the knowledge and confidence needed to advance into VFS’s Film Production, Writing for Film, Television & Games and Sound Design for Visual Media programs.

Program Overview

Term 01

Build your filmmaking foundations by learning screenplay structure, script formatting, and visual storytelling. Evoke emotion by applying camera perspective and shot composition during hands-on training with cameras, lenses, lighting, and green screen. Shape narratives with editing theory, color correction, and layering sound. Practice directing and producing basics with script analysis, blocking, obtaining permits and releases, and marketing considerations.

Term 02

Deepen your screenwriting skills by exploring character relationships, theme, and dialogue. Expand your visual storytelling toolkit by creating storyboards and animatics that use silhouettes, value, and color to guide viewer focus and emotion. Develop on-set audio recording techniques alongside foley creation, voice editing, and mixing, while practicing a wider range of directing and cinematography concepts directly in workshops and a team-based short film project.

Admissions Requirements: 

There are no program specific entrance requirements.

Foundation – Film is ideal for those requiring art portfolio development to enter VFS’s full-time Film Production, Writing for Film, Television, and Games, and Sound Design for Visual Media programs, or for those that enjoy filmmaking, screenwriting and/or sound design and are looking to explore careers in these areas.  

If English is not your first language, you will be required to meet Level 1 of VFS’s ESL Requirements, which includes a variety of eligible ESL tests. Click here for full information on VFS’s Language Requirements.

International students require a valid study permit (student visa) to study at VFS in Canada. VFS provides guidance on applying for study permits, but it is the student’s responsibility to complete the application through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C).

VFS does not provide on-campus housing, but our Student Services team can help connect you to a variety of housing options, including student residences, private rentals, or homestays. We recommend arranging accommodations as early as possible, as Vancouver’s rental market is competitive.
